  • Product Line Engineering(PLE) is one of the technologies that develop applications economically reusing core assets. PLE consists of Framework Engineering(FE) and Application Engineering. Framework Engineering is to develop core assets that have common functionality shared by a set of family members. Application Engineering is to develop a specific application by instantiating the core assets. The PLE process increases reusability and efficiency because a specific application is developed by using core assets with less time and effort. Since definition of PLE artifacts and relationship between artifacts are not clear. developers have several troubles to make artifacts based on PLE process, are difficult to maintain consistency between artifacts, and do not use PLE process more practically. In this paper, we define meta-models of artifacts that are produced in PLE activities of PLE process and describe the traceability relationship between artifacts by using traceability map and guidelines that can apply traceability relationship. Finally, we define the way how trace links and guidelines of traceability map are applied.

  • 본 연구는 한국어 어말어미 산출시 나타나는 대뇌 활성화 영역을 살펴보기 위하여 실시되었다. 두 가지 실험이 실시되었다 실험 1은 어말어미의 기본형을 주고 이를 의문형, 명령형으로 산출하는 고립단어 실험을 실시하였다. 통제 조건으로 모음변환조건(C1)과 아라비아문자보기(C2)를 사용하였다. 실험 1의 결과 ‘어말어미-C1’ 조건에서 좌반구의 측두엽과 전두엽부분의 의 활성화 superior temporal gyrus와 inferior frontal gyrus의 활성화가 관찰되었다. ‘어말어미-C2’ 의 조건에서 우반구에서 후두엽의 활성화와 좌반구에서의 후두엽, 전두엽, lingual G, Cuneus, fusiform G, inferior occipital G에서의 활성화를 관찰할 수 있었다. 실험 2는 명령형과 의문형 어미의 형태점화효과와 관련된 대뇌 활성화 영역을 관찰하기 위하여 Er-fMRI 기법을 이용하여 실시되었다. 실험 조건은 어미동일조건, 어간반복조건, 무관련 조건으로 구성되었다. 피험자들은 점화자극이 제시된 후 신호가 제시되고 나오는 표적단어를 의문형 또는 명령으로 산출하도록 하는 과제를 실시하였다. 뇌 활성화 영역을 분석한 결과 의문형과 명령형을 산출할 때의 활성화 영역에서 $^{\ast}^{\ast}^{\ast}$를 볼 때의 영역을 빼기 (substraction)한 결과 공통적으로 좌반구 브로카 영역이 활성화되었고, 의문형과 명령형 안에서 어미동일조건에서 무관련 조건을 뺀 경우에는 좌반구의 superior temporal G 영역의 활성화가 관찰되었다. 이들 결과를 종합해 볼 때 어말어미 산출 그 자체와 직접 관련되는 영역으로는 좌반구의 측두엽과 전두엽 부분이 관찰되었다. 특히 한국어 어말어미 산출시 나타나는 형태점화 양상과 관련된 대뇌영역으로 발견된 브로카 영역에서의 활성화는 어미 변환과 관련된 영역이라기보다는 산출시 관련되는 articulation, motor coordinate관련 영역으로 추정되고, 측두엽의 활성화는 형태소, 의미 관련 지식의 data base로 추정된다. 또한 우반구 전두엽 부분에서 관찰된 활성화는 억제관련 영역으로 짐작된다.

  • Recently, the interests in three-dimensional design and BIM(Building Information Modeling) are increasing in civil engineering sector and the researches about three-dimensional design and quantity take-off methods for civil engineering structures have been conducted. However, these studies are just carried out the 3D design and quantity calculation of civil structures on the road or railway such as bridges and tunnels. The study on the quantity take-off methods and the evaluation of calculated results on the earth works should be performed in more detail. Based on these backgrounds in mind, the study was conducted the three-dimensional road design and evaluated the quantity take-off results on the earth works using 3D calculation method(average end area method, prismoidal method and composit method). The calculated quantity from composit method showed about 5% error of measuring efficiency than the average end area method, and when reporting the quantity calculation of earth works, it is necessary to specify the calculation method using quantity take-off of earth works.

  • Reinforcing steel work plays an important role in terms of its structural performance or weight of construction cost for reinforced concrete structures. Precise estimation of re-bar quantity gives a basis for managing the reinforcing steel work effectively. However, the estimation process is still performed ineffectively based upon the expert's experience or manpower in spite of the advanced technology or improvement efforts. Therefore, the purpose of this research is to develop a prototype system for taking-off the quantity of reinforcing steel bars quickly and accurately in an order consistent with the specific members identified on the drawings. An estimate algorithm considering the connection, settlement and coating thickness of re-bars was suggested regarding to their replacement conditions which places more emphasis on constructibility. Also, this system produces the shop drawings automatically with the calculation results.

  • Recently, as the 3G services of Korea have stepped into the developing stage and the traffic has been rapidly increasing, the spectrum requirements have been getting very large. Therefore spectrum reforming is considered actively and firstly exact methodology of spectrum requirement estimation is needed. But existing methodology depends on the future's service forecast than the present substantial data. This paper proposed the exact methodology of spectrum requirement estimation is based on the real data. So this paper analyzed the characteristics of Korean mobile communication traffic based on the real data and the algorithm suitable for estimation of spectrum requirements for 3G mobile communications, and calculated the parameters needed to estimate the spectrum requirements. Based on the traffic parameters of December 2007, simulations to Bet the estimation of annual spectrum requirements were implemented for the two different cases: one of which is 44 % annual increase in the data traffic and the other is 21 % annual increase. The simulation results show 90 MHz for the first case and 60 MHz for the second case in December 2011.

  • This study is for the segmentation and volume calculation of the white matter and gray matter from brain MRI. In general, the volume of white and gray matter is reduced by contraction of each components in the case of mental retardation which are Alzheimer's disease and Down's syndrome. As results, it is useful for diagnostic and early detection for various mental retardation through the tracing of variation for its volume from the brain MRI. But, until now, it was very difficult to calculate the partial volume of each components existing in some thickness, because MR image was represented by single gray value after scanning by MR scanner. Accordingly, new segmentation algorithm proposed in this paper is to calculate the partial volume of the white and gray matter existing in some thickness through the analysis of the blurred gray value, and is to determine the threshold for segmentation of white and gray matter, and is to calculate the volume of each segmented component. And finally, proposed algorithm was applied the models which was created manually, and then acquired results was compared with that of original model.
